Transaction 2954454eda60ee43139c71908f964f76d76c1e7293f70b1bb93fb491bfc52dd0

1 Input
2 Outputs
  • 2954454eda60ee43139c71908f964f76d76c1e7293f70b1bb93fb491bfc52dd0:0
  • value  244667
    address  1GaSrX4j3Te4n4N5GmpM9FcTUHEJkNVFA9
  • 2954454eda60ee43139c71908f964f76d76c1e7293f70b1bb93fb491bfc52dd0:1
  • value  209613086
    address  3LFSPN9Xrot98GY5HbEQuK4a5N5U7xYR4Q